Joined @endometriosisuk.bsky.social in Parliament to support their #EndometriosisActionMonth.
The new statistics are alarming. The average diagnosis time has now risen to 9 years & 4 months, up from 8 years in 2020.
There is an urgent need to reduce diagnosis times to under 1 year by 2030.

Thrilled to support my colleague @monicalennon.bsky.social at her reception marking #EndometriosisActionMonth.
Endometriosis affects 1 in 10 women, with an average diagnosis time of nearly 9 years and long waits for gynaecology appointments.

Endometriosis affects 1.5 million people from puberty to menopause, although the impact may be felt for life.
Such a common and often debilitating disease deserves the same recognition as conditions like diabetes and asthma.
